<DIV><FONT face=Arial size=2>Just an FYI, there is no difference in serum in a 1
year or a 3 year Rabies Vaccination, the only difference is how it is
marked on the certificate. And the amount given to a dog does not differ
regardless of whether your dog is 2 lbs. or 200 lbs. (stupid). Hopefully
you are fortunate enough to live in an area that only requires Rabies shots
every 3 years. And a dog that has any sort of "dis"ease, should not be
given a vaccination PERIOD. Vets can, and do, give exemptions for rabies
for dogs who are suffering chronic or terminal illnesses. </FONT></DIV>
